===Central-West Region=== {{Main|Central-West Region, Brazil}} [[File:Brazil Region CentroOeste.svg|right|200px]] *Area: 1,612,007.2 km<sup>2</sup> (18.86%) *Population: 16,289,538 (7.2 people/km<sup>2</sup>; 6.4%) *GDP: [[Brazilian real|R$]]279 billion / [[United States dollar|US$]]174,3 billion (2008; 8.3%) <small> ([[Economy of Brazil|4th]])</small> *Climate: Savanna climate (hot, with little precipitation during winter in the northeast and the east; Tropical in the east and in the west; Equatorial in the north; Some temperate climate places in the south). *States: [[Goiás]], [[Mato Grosso]], [[Mato Grosso do Sul]], [[Federal District (Brazil)|Distrito Federal]] (Federal District). *Largest Cities: [[Brasília]] (national capital) (2,562,963); [[Goiânia]] (1,318,148); [[Campo Grande]] (796,252); [[Cuiabá]] (556,298); [[Aparecida de Goiânia]] (442,978); [[Anápolis]] (334,613). *Economy: [[Animal husbandry in Brazil|Livestock]],<ref name="agenciadenoticias.ibge.gov.br"/> [[Agriculture in Brazil|Soybeans, Maize, Sugarcane, Cotton, Tomato]],<ref name="ReferenceA"/><ref name="Brazil's Agriculture by FAO"/> [[Mining in Brazil|Nickel, Copper, Gold]],<ref name="Brazilian Mineral Yearbook"/> tourism.<ref name="dadosefatos.turismo.gov.br"/><ref name="Industry in Brazil"/><ref name="irena.org"/> *Transport: Highways where they are present (mostly in the center and east regions); transport by rivers is common in the north and in the east; airplanes are used in remote and smaller communities. *Vegetation: Mainly savanna-like vegetation, including the [[Pantanal]] ([[Chaco Department|Chaco]], in [[Paraguay]]), flooded areas in the west, equatorial rainforests in the north. *Notable characteristics: With a low population density, most of the land in the region is used for grazing instead of agriculture. The region is also the least industrialized in the country, based mainly in food & meat processing.
